MT-King's 2006 Jeep TJ

 

Mods-
* slip yoke eliminator

* Tom Woods drive shaft

* 4.5 Rubicon express long arm lift

* BFGoodrich 35/12.5/15 mud-terrains

* 15" Mickey thompson Classic II's

* Sirius satillite radio

* Old Man Emu 4.5 nitro charger shocks

* RE sway-bar disconnects

* Jeeperman rear bumper w/ tire swing

* Jeeperman rock rails

* Jeep-Aid engine skid

* VDP cool breeze summer top

* soft-top quick disconnects

* ARB air-locker

* ARB air compressor

* Dynatrac dana 44 diff cover

* Dynatrac dana 30 diff cover

* Yukon 4.56 gears

* HiLift jack

* Cobra CB w/ 3' FireStick antenna

* Fire Extinguisher

* ARB fill-up hose

* Alpine 600watt Amp

* (2) Alpine 10" TypeR subs

* (2) Alpine TypeR speakers

* Jeep neoprene seat-covers

* Quadratec grab-handles

* Speedometer calibration gear
